Skill:
Core Java
Skill Category:
Java Development
Experience:
6 - 8 Years
Title:
Full Stack Java Developer with 6-8 years of Experience in Core Java, Databases along with experience in some or the other front end technology
Job Description:
Write high-quality code using the guidelines and effectively debug the code.
Document the code changes, package the code, unit test it.
Perform the task assigned as per their prioritization and implement a solution.
Act upon the suggestions provided during the code reviews.
Work with the application development team in delivering the project and deliverables within time and with good quality.
Assess requirements for new and enhanced functionalities; identify the impact on existing applications, operating systems, hardware, and network.
Perform unit testing, ensure quality assurance of applications through system testing.
Keep up-to-date with latest technologies, trends and provides inputs/recommendations to the project manager or the architect as required.
Coordinate and communicate with the other tracks and disciplines involved in the project.
Knowledge and Skills:
Must Have:
Working experience on Core Java, REST API, , Junit/Mockito, Spring/Hibernate.
Strong in coding and good in concepts like OOPS Concepts, Data Structures, Multithreading, and Design Patterns
Springboot 2.0. x (web packages) for building RESTful application components.
Exposure to any of front end tech like ExtJS\Angular\ReactJS\JavaScript is mandatory
Good exposure to Database queries and comfortable with joins.
Practical exposure to operating code repositories like Bitbucket, GitHub, etc.
Must have exposure to different application servers, configuration systems.